Product Description
The Intel G43186-150 is a MIDPLANE SAS Backplane, a specialized component designed for Intel server platforms that utilize SAS (Serial Attached SCSI) storage devices. A midplane is an intermediate board that connects components, often allowing for a cleaner internal layout and easier access to drives. This particular backplane is engineered to provide the necessary physical and electrical connections for SAS drives, ensuring robust and high-speed data transfer. This backplane board plays a critical role in the server's storage architecture by acting as a central hub for SAS drives. It interfaces with the server's main system board or RAID controller, managing the communication pathways for multiple SAS drives. The use of SAS technology ensures high performance, reliability, and scalability for storage solutions, making it suitable for demanding enterprise applications.
